The marine layer is not so much a factor this April, 1998 evening as a small tropical system comes in with a drop in the jet stream. Operator Joe Valadez tollerated a young Carman with a 35mm camera loaded with Scala 200 and a desire to capture the Santa Fe Redondo Jct. tower inside and out before it was closed.
